What Makes Rockrimmon Different From Every Other Colorado Springs Neighborhood

Rockrimmon developed primarily between the 1970s and 1990s, shaped directly by the Rocky Mountain front range terrain it sits within. That origin story matters for sellers. Homes here were built into the landscape rather than placed on it. Winding roads follow natural contours. Lots slope, drop, and rise in ways that automated valuation tools cannot process. Custom mountain-style builds, mid-century split-levels, and low-maintenance townhomes each occupy the same zip code but appeal to very different buyers – and require very different marketing strategies.

Furthermore, no two Rockrimmon homes are truly comparable. A canyon-facing lot with Pikes Peak sightlines commands a premium that a street-facing home two blocks away simply does not. Generalist agents averaging comparables across the neighborhood consistently misprice these properties. That mispricing costs sellers real money.

Rockrimmon’s Unique Seller Preparation Requirements

Selling in Rockrimmon involves Colorado-specific requirements that many agents overlook. Sellers must navigate several important factors before listing:

  • Wildland-Urban Interface (WUI) zone compliance – Ponderosa Pine proximity creates defensible space requirements that affect both seller disclosure and buyer qualification
  • HOA document delivery under Colorado HB 22-1137 – multiple HOAs operate within Rockrimmon, including sub-community associations in Discovery and Rockrimmon Estates
  • Colorado Seller Property Disclosure (SPD) form requirements, including mineral rights disclosure
  • Radon testing – El Paso County’s geological profile elevates radon risk in custom homes throughout the area
  • Septic versus municipal sewer verification for applicable properties
  • Academy D20 school zone confirmation for marketing materials

When Is the Best Time to List a Rockrimmon Home?

Spring and early summer represent the strongest listing windows for Rockrimmon. The Academy District 20 school calendar drives family buyer timelines. Most families want to be settled before the school year begins in late August. However, Rockrimmon also offers a compelling case for fall listings. Scrub oak turns vivid amber and gold in September and October. Morning light across the bluffs creates listing photography that genuinely stops buyers mid-scroll. A well-prepared fall listing can generate exceptional results for sellers willing to act before winter slows activity.

Frequently Asked Questions
What are the disclosure requirements for selling a home in Rockrimmon, Colorado Springs?

Colorado requires sellers to complete a Seller Property Disclosure (SPD) form that covers structural conditions, environmental factors, and material defects. Rockrimmon sellers should also disclose wildland-urban interface zone status, mineral rights, radon testing results, and applicable HOA information under Colorado HB 22-1137. Working with a local listing agent familiar with El Paso County requirements helps ensure full compliance before the property goes to market.

How do Rockrimmon home values compare to other Colorado Springs neighborhoods?

Rockrimmon home values are influenced by factors unique to the 80919 zip code, including view lot premiums, Academy District 20 school access, Ute Valley Park proximity, and custom architectural features that standard valuation tools cannot accurately capture. Because inventory is naturally constrained by the terrain, Rockrimmon tends to hold value well even during broader market softening. A professional comparative market analysis from an experienced local agent provides a far more accurate price estimate than automated online tools.
